Output 65106c544aa9104a988dab4f630314754d619e7e74b61a0e370afe9a75ceb8e8: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68dba10b90b9b93afd5f138128652ad7f07a1803 OP_EQUAL
address
3BFTJbC4iAMH5ojv3iQKjrGjTP3uMYfQMK
transaction
65106c544aa9104a988dab4f630314754d619e7e74b61a0e370afe9a75ceb8e8
spent
true